World Cup 'ruined' by 'predictable' Colombo weather
The Women's World Cup has faced significant challenges due to the unpredictable weather in Colombo, with former England spinner Alex Hartley stating that it has 'ruined' the tournament. This situation is concerning as it not only affects the players and teams but also the fans and the overall experience of the event, highlighting the impact of weather on sports.
